Abstract

Genericity, as in Ada or ML, and inheritance, as in object-oriented languages, are two alternative techniques for ensuring better extendibility, reusability and compatibility of software components. This article is a comparative analysis of these two methods. It studies their similarities and differences and assesses to what extent each may be simulated in a language offering only the other. It shows what features are needed to successfully combine the two approaches in a statically typed language and presents the main features of the programming language Eiffel, whose design, resulting in part from this study, includes multiple inheritance and limited form of genericity under full static typing.
